WebTemporary, short-term car insurance is available if you need to drive another vehicle for a few days. The cover can be provided for anywhere between one and 28 days. Some short-term policies cover drivers aged … WebJan 24, 2024 · To insure a car, most car insurance companies will require you to have an insurable interest in it. This means you would be affected financially if the car were damaged or totaled. Thus, typically, only car owners, co-owners or lienholders have an insurable interest in a vehicle and can place car insurance on it.

WebJun 21, 2024 · In most cases, if you give permission to someone else to drive your car (making them a permissive driver) and they cause an accident, your insurance will cover the costs. That’s because yours will be the primary insurance, whether or not you were in the car with them at the time.
